About Repurpose Journey

Repurpose Journey is all about finding new paths in life and embracing change with courage, gratitude, and purpose. Hosted by Laura, who shares her own experience with Meniere’s Disease, this show offers inspiring interviews and honest conversations, we explore stories of individuals who have transformed their lives, discovering fresh perspectives and passions. Whether you’re facing a life transition, on your own healing journey or supporting a loved one, you’ll find connection, courage, and inspiration here.

What Is Menieres Disease and What Has Changed for me - Chronic Illness - Invisible Illness - Vestibular Disease What is Ménière’s Disease really like? In this deeply personal episode of Repurpose Journey, I share my 10-year journey living with Ménière’s Disease — from the terrifying early symptoms of vertigo, migraines, and heart palpitations to the grief of losing predictability and learning to live within new limits. If you’ve ever searched: * What does vertigo actually feel like? * Is Ménière’s Disease serious? * Why does chronic illness feel so exhausting? * Why do I look fine but feel awful inside? This episode is for you. I talk honestly about: * The early warning signs and diagnosis process * Being dismissed and gaslit by doctors * Finding a physician who finally listened * What vertigo truly feels like * Hearing loss and balance challenges * The emotional and spiritual grief of invisible illness * Marriage and family support during chronic illness * Trusting God when healing doesn’t come the way you hoped Ménière’s Disease is a chronic inner ear disorder that affects balance and hearing. It often includes episodes of vertigo, tinnitus (ringing in the ears), hearing loss, and ear pressure. There is no cure — only management. But this episode is about more than symptoms. It’s about what happens when life doesn’t go as planned. It’s about grief, surrender, hope, and faith in the middle of chronic illness. It’s about what God does with what we didn’t choose. If you live with chronic illness, you are not weak. If you love someone who does, your compassion matters.
